The Origins of Flat Earth Theory
It may surprise you, but the idea that
the Earth is flat isn't something that sprung up from the Internet age or
modern conspiracy theories—it's actually a belief that stretches back thousands
of years. In ancient times, when early humans began to explore the world around
them, the flat earth model made a lot of sense. After all, when you look at the
horizon, everything seems pretty flat, right?
The ancient Egyptians, Mesopotamians, and even some early Greeks believed the earth was flat, like a giant disk floating on water. They didn't have telescopes, satellite imagery or the scientific methods we have today. Their understanding was based on what they could see, and it's easy to imagine how this might seem like the most logical conclusion without modern tools.
However, it didn't take long for
curious minds to challenge this view. Around the 6th century BC, Greek
philosophers such as Pythagoras
and, later, Aristotle began to
question the flat earth model. They observed that during a lunar eclipse, the
Earth's shadow on the Moon was always spherical. Also, ships disappearing
hull-first above the horizon hinted that the Earth might not be flat. These
observations, along with advances in astronomy
and mathematics,
eventually led to the understanding that the Earth is a sphere.
Fast forward to the Middle Ages and the
Renaissance, and the round Earth became a widely accepted fact, especially
after explorers like Ferdinand
Magellan circumnavigated the globe. For most of history thereafter, the
flat earth belief faded into obscurity, a relic of an ancient misunderstanding.
But even as science and exploration provided overwhelming evidence for a round earth, small pockets of flat earth believers still existed. It wasn't until modern times with the rise of the internet and social media that these ancient beliefs found a new platform to spread. Ironically, in our age of modern technology, these ideas from the distant past have found new life in a very modern world.

Why The Earth is Clearly Round?
Let's get one thing straight: the Earth
is round, and it's not just because someone told you so—because there's a
mountain of evidence built up over thousands of years.
If you travel a long road and drive in
only one direction, eventually, you will end up where you started. This is the
easiest way to understand that the earth is not flat. But if that's not
convincing enough, let's dive into the science that actually proves it.
First, we have astronomical
observations. For centuries, astronomers have been studying the sky and one
thing they have noticed is that every other planet we can see through a
telescope is round. Why would the only shape of the earth be different? Not to
mention, during a Lunar
Eclipse, the Earth casts a shadow on the Moon. That shadow is always
curved, no matter where on Earth the eclipse is viewed—because our planet is a
sphere!
Then there's gravity. Gravity pulls everything towards the center of the Earth and that force is what gives the planet its spherical shape. If the Earth were flat, gravity wouldn't work the same way. We'll experience some really weird things, like people feeling heavier at the edges and lighter in the middle. Fortunately for us, gravity works exactly the same way on a spherical Earth.
And what about modern satellite
technology? We have literally sent humans into space, and we have pictures from
space that show the Earth as a globe. Satellites orbit the Earth, and they give
us real-time pictures of the entire planet. These are the same satellites we
rely on for GPS and weather forecasting—things we use in everyday life that
wouldn't work if the Earth were flat.
But before the space age, people were proving that the earth is round. Explorers like Ferdinand Magellan sailed around the world in the 1500s, proving that you could travel in a straight line and eventually return to where you started. And more than 2,000 years ago, Greek mathematicians like Eratosthenes used shadows and geometry to calculate the circumference of the Earth. He was only a few hundred miles away, and he didn't even have modern equipment!
So, when it comes to the shape of the
Earth, science speaks loud and clear. From the way gravity works, to the way we
navigate the world, from space to scenery, the evidence is everywhere. The
Earth isn't just round because someone told you—it's round because centuries of
scientific observation and research have shown us so.
Psychology of Conspiracy
At first glance, it is hard to
understand why anyone would believe the Earth is flat when science proves it is
round. But here's the thing - people don't just wake up one day and decide to believe
something that goes against all the evidence. There is a deep psychology behind
it and it starts with how our mind works.
Humans have this natural tendency to
look for patterns and explanations, especially for things that seem mysterious
or difficult to understand. We like to feel in control, and sometimes, simple
answers—like "the Earth is flat"—seem easier to grasp than otherwise
proven complex science. This desire for clear answers can open the door to
conspiracy thinking, where people begin to believe that some secret truth is
being kept from them.
A big reason some still believe in the
flat earth theory is Cognitive Bias – basically, how our brains like to
stick to ideas we're already comfortable with. Once someone begins to think
that the Earth may be flat, they begin to ignore or minimize any evidence that
contradicts that belief. Instead, they focus on things that support their new
perspective, even if those things aren't based on facts. It's like wearing
glasses that only show what you want to see.
Another piece of the puzzle is Distrust
of Authority. Many flat earth believers feel that governments, scientists,
and the educational system are hiding the "truth" from them. In a
world where people are increasingly suspicious of institutions - because of
political scandals, misinformation or just a general sense of being lied to -
the flat earth theory can seem like a rebellious way to reject mainstream
ideas. It's not just about the shape of the Earth; It's about feeling like
you've uncovered a secret that "they" don't want you to know.
Then there's the appeal of being part
of a Contrarian Narrative—going against the grain. For some, believing
in a flat earth gives them a sense of identity, making them feel like they
belong in something most people don't understand. It's not just a belief, it
becomes a part of who they are, a way to stand out from the crowd. When someone
thinks they are part of an Enlightened group that knows something others don't,
it can be hard to let go, even in the face of overwhelming evidence to the
contrary.
Ultimately, the psychology behind
conspiracy theories like flat earth thinking is more than a rejection of
science. It's about human nature—our need to make sense of the world, the
biases that shape our beliefs, and the communities that make us perceive
ourselves, even if those beliefs are based on misinformation. Understanding why
people are drawn to these ideas helps us see that it's not just about facts and
logic; How we as humans process and hold the beliefs that make us feel safe.
The Culture Clash
Imagine you're sitting at a table with a group of scientists, astronauts, and educators—who have spent their entire lives studying the universe, flying into space, and teaching generations of students about the world. Now, among them is a group of flat earth believers, equally passionate, who are convinced that what these experts are saying is wrong. This is where the cultural clash begins.
On the one hand, you have Scientists
and Astronauts, armed with data, experiments and first-hand experience.
These are people who literally went into space and saw the Earth as a bright
blue sphere. For them, the shape of the Earth is not even a debate - it is a
scientific fact supported by centuries of evidence. Astronauts like Chris
Hadfield have spoken openly about their frustrations with the flat earth
theory, sharing photos from space and describing their experiences seeing the
Earth curve with their own eyes.
Then you have Educators, who are
responsible for teaching science in the classroom. They work hard to make sure
students understand concepts like gravity, planetary motion, and the laws of
physics. But when students come to class questioning basics like the shape of
the Earth—often because they've come across the flat Earth concept online—it
puts teachers in a tricky spot. They need to balance correcting misinformation
while encouraging curiosity and critical thinking.
Flat Earthers, on the other
hand, are just as committed to their opinions. Many truly believe that
scientists and astronauts are part of a global conspiracy to hide the truth
about the shape of the Earth. They argue that all photos from space are fake,
and they challenge well-established facts with questions that seem logical to
them on the surface: "If the Earth is round, why doesn't water fall? Why
don't we see curves when we look at the horizon?"
This conflict has led to some pretty
public clashes. Debates between Flat Earthers and experts have taken place on
podcasts, TV shows, and even conferences. One of the most notable moments was
when astrophysicist Neil
deGrasse Tyson famously responded to a rapper promoting the flat earth
theory. Tyson passionately explained why the world is round,
but the exchange highlighted how challenging it can be to change one's deeply
held beliefs, especially when those beliefs are connected to a sense of
identity or distrust of authority.
For experts, it's not just about
protecting science — it's about protecting public understanding and ensuring
future generations aren't misled by misinformation. But for Flat Earthers,
fighting against what they see as an oppressive system of lies, what they
believe is the real truth.
This cultural clash is not just about
the shape of the world. It's about trust in science, the power of
misinformation, and the difficult task of bridging the gap between established
facts and deeply held alternative beliefs. Both sides think they're fighting
for something bigger—whether it's protecting scientific knowledge or revealing
what they believe is a hidden truth—and that's what makes this conflict so
complicated.

Global Impact
At first glance, the flat earth theory
may seem like an innocuous, fringe idea, but its impact on society goes much
deeper than the debate over the size of our planet. In reality, the flat earth
idea connects to some big issues that affect how we, as a society, interact
with science, information and people of faith to guide us.
One of the biggest impacts is Science
Education. When people buy into flat earth ideas, they begin to question
basic scientific facts that are fundamental to understanding the world around
us. Classroom teachers are now encountering students who are already skeptical
of topics like gravity, the solar system, and even physics, because they've
watched online videos or joined flat earth groups. This makes teaching science
difficult when students question its foundations. Imagine trying to teach
someone about space exploration or climate change who doesn't even believe the
Earth is round - that's a huge challenge.
But there is a problem of Misinformation
beyond education. Flat Earth thinking spreads as easily as false information
spreads on social media. We live in a time where anyone can post a video, write
an article or create a meme and if it's interesting or controversial enough it
can go viral, whether it's true or not. The Flat Earth theme taps into people's
curiosity and disbelief, and the more it spreads, the more it blurs the line
between fact and fiction. And it's not just about flat Earth—this kind of
misinformation can easily spread to other areas like health, politics, and
climate change, making it hard for people to know what's real.
Another serious effect is Public
Trust in Experts and Institutions. Flat Earth thinking feeds into a larger
tendency to reject authority – be it scientists, academics or even government.
Those who believe in the flat earth often feel that they have been lied to by
the "establishment" and that mainstream experts are hiding the truth.
This distrust is not limited to one subject; This can turn into a common
skepticism about any kind of skill. Over time, this erodes trust in the
institutions we rely on for important information, such as health care,
environmental policy, or scientific research.
The spread of flat earth thinking is a
reminder that what we believe can have real consequences for society. When
people start to doubt science, accept misinformation and lose trust in experts,
it creates a world where making informed decisions becomes much more difficult.
Whether it's how to protect the environment, understand public health guidelines,
or navigate the vast amount of information we're bombarded with every day, this
shift can affect everyone—not just those who believe the world isn't flat.
